Detention basins, levee banks, housing buybacks on floodplains, house-raising schemes and planning controls have been introduced to mitigate the impacts of future flooding of the Georges River, but these wont prevent flooding. The river and its tributary creeks represent Sydney's most immediate flood problem, both in terms of the number of properties affected by flooding and the potential for increased flood damage due to development pressures within the catchment. After 20 years of mining, the riverbanks were packed with dangerous pits and eroded banks. Thus whilst the Georges River has a long history of flooding, those floods that are Floods are measured on a scale of the amount of time they are expected to reoccur, based on available records.
